Changes to Local Law 2 reflect community feedback

Latrobe City Council has responded to community feedback about its proposed Local Law No.2 with a modified version of the law.

Earlier this year, Council put forward a proposed Community Amenity Local Law No.2 to supersede the current Local Law No.2 2009.

Latrobe City Council’s mayor, Councillor Michael Rossiter, said the proposed law was put to the community and many submissions were received objecting to parts of the proposed law.

"Council has listened to community feedback and has developed the Proposed Community Amenity Local Law No.2 2016," Cr Rossiter said.

"We’ve changed the wording to better reflect the community’s desires. We’ve resolved issues around the use of council parks, gardens and recreational reserves by the general public. A clause that restricted use of recreational vehicles on private properties has been completely removed.

"Changes to the wording of a clause about dilapidated buildings will strengthen penalties for commercial and industrial buildings, recognising the impact these ugly buildings have on the community."

The purposes of this Local Law include to prohibit, regulate and control activities, events, practices or behaviour on Council land, public places and private property, and to protect Council’s assets and regulate their use.

"Proposed Community Amenity Local Law No.2 2016 will be open for submissions until Thursday, 28 July 2016. We value your feedback and if you want to make a submission there are a number of ways in which you can do that, either online, in person, by email to latrobe@latrobe.vic.gov.au or by mail.

"To view the draft document and make a submission, attend your local service centre, call 1300 367 700 or visit www.latrobe.vic.gov.au/locallaw2," Cr Rossiter concluded.

A public meeting is scheduled for Thursday, 21 July at 6pm in the Nambur Wariga Meeting Room, Latrobe City Council Headquarters, 141 Commercial Road, Morwell for interested community members who would like to discuss their concerns with Council staff.

Following the conclusion of the community consultation period, submissions will be considered at the Ordinary Council Meeting on Monday, 22 August, commencing at 6pm in the Nambur Wariga Meeting Room.
